DevOps Engineer
Porto, Portugal
há 4 dias

Job Description

Are you ready to shape the future of travel by working at one of the world’s largest online travel companies? At eDreams ODIGEO you will have a real impact, combining more than 600 airlines and 100.

000 flights worldwide every day into billions of potential combinations and helping our users find the very best travel deals.

We are looking for a driven DevOps Engineer to join our Porto headquarters.

You will be in charge of building and developing Europe’s largest flight retailing platform which last year served over 18 million customers in 46 different markets through more than 60 million searches every day.

We set the path. Shape the way people travel with us.

At eDreams ODIGEO, we believe in full end to end ownership of results and empower our teams to develop solutions that benefit both the customer and our business, iterating fast to continuously learn and improve.

We are a fully agile organisation, and our product development teams use Kanban practices to deliver business value continuously.

You will be part of an Agile multidisciplinary team where you will influence both product and technical decisions on a day-to-day basis.

The DevOps engineer will be working hand in hand with product development teams, focusing on infrastructure and automation to ensure the maximum autonomy of the product teams.

He / she will do this by collaborating with development and platform teams to build, deploy and maintain the company services, automating all processes to provide maximum autonomy.

You will be joining us at an exciting time of change. We have set ourselves an ambitious goal of migrating our website platform from on-premises datacenter (docker mesos platform) to Google Cloud Platform (GKE) so that we deploy our stack closer to our customers to provide the best experience possible.

You will work with a top-notch tech stack , including :

  • Google Cloud
  • Oracle Cloud
  • GCVE
  • GKE / Kubernetes
  • Terragrunt
  • Kafka & PubSub
  • noSQL Databases (Cassandra, Elastic search, BigTable )
  • Zookeeper
  • and many many more!
  • In your role of DevOps, your main day to day responsibilities include :

  • Design cloud infrastructure that is secure, scalable and highly available on GCP.
  • Define infrastructure and deployment requirements.
  • Provision, configure and maintain cloud infrastructure defined as a code
  • Build and maintain operation tools for deployment, monitoring and analysis of cloud infrastructure and systems
  • Ensure configuration and compliance with configuration management tools
  • Work collaboratively with product development being the link between product and business units
  • Focus on process automation to allow maximum autonomy for development teams
  • We are looking for a very strong individual that displays these characteristics :
  • Strong understanding of how to secure cloud environments and meet compliance requirements
  • Solid foundation on networking and linux administration
  • Experience with docker, Kubernetes, Jenkins, ELK and deploying application in cloud
  • Hands on experience deploying and managing infrastructure with Terraform
  • Experience with noSQL Databases (cassandra, elasticsearch) (desirable)
  • Experience with Queue systems (kafka, pubsub) (desirable)
  • Experience with java jvm jboss application servers (desirable)
  • Experience with scripting programming languages like python and go
  • Strong understanding and experience architecting microservices technology
  • Ability to troubleshoot problems across a wide array of services and functional areas
  • Energetic team player who enjoys working in an agile development culture.
  • Strong bias for action, ownership and solving head-scratching challenges
  • Personal interest for continuous learning and self improvement.
  • Do you have a real passion for designing, building and maintaining a high-traffic website platform? Join us and demonstrate your expert DevOps knowledge.
  • What do we offer?

  • Safe environment during COVID times : Onboarding and daily work can be done 100% remote.
  • Excellent environment for continuous growth and learning : with our Learning & Development programs, you will have access to frequent tech talks from internal experts and external keynote speakers, a broad range of internal soft skills and technical skills training opportunities, organised language lessons, and paid-for access to external events and industry conferences.
  • At any point in time, you will also have access to an extensive digital learning platform through a free subscription to O’Reilly Online Learning.

  • Fast-track career development : With our unique structured programs, you are always working towards the next step on your career path.
  • We have well defined career path programmes for our platform engineers. The typical career path is going from tech support engineer, to system engineer, to senior system engineer and then up to either a people management role (Platform Lead) or a more technical expertise based role (technical expert for a technology).

    You will receive full support from experienced people managers to give you the training, coaching and support you need to accelerate your career within eDreams.

  • A phenomenal lifestyle and work-life-balance : Our teams regularly take the time to do team building activities, we provide access to flexible hours and a generous holiday allowance of 24 days per year, plus we work in a compressed 6 hour schedule every Friday all year round.
  • A free eDreams Prime subscription that allows you to benefit from significant discounts on all your travels.
  • Freedom to experiment and use different technologies.
  • A great team experience : You will work in a stable and high performing team, really taking ownership of a product end to end.
  • You own the entire platform stack, you own the technical decisions (with support from architects), you manage your infrastructure, tools and processes and then you go beyond.

    You own the customer understanding, and eventually the business domain. Meaning you have maximum chances to make an impact on the business and have your product seen and used by more than 100 million customers each year who make more than 15 billion searches every year.

    Where else would you have this kind of exposure and ownership? The fact we give you so much ownership means you get to solve super interesting technical and business challenges.

  • Competitive compensation package with an attractive bonus structure.
  • Social benefits schemes like Ticket Restaurant.
  • We also have for you a Ticket Restaurant benefit & unlimited beverages and coffee for free at the office (with many types of milk alternatives) because we like our eDOers happy and healthy!
  • Additional prizes and awards for a variety of team and individual achievements.
  • Fun at work : At eDreams ODIGEO, work and fun go hand in hand!
  • And the opportunity to work in a dynamic, dedicated, fun and passionate team of professionals. We journey together!

    Reportar esta oferta de trabalho

    Thank you for reporting this job!

    Your feedback will help us improve the quality of our services.

    Meu email
    Ao clicar em "Continue", autorizo a neuvoo a processar os meus dados e a enviar-me alertas de e-mail, conforme detalhado na Política de Privacidade da neuvoo . Posso retirar o meu consentimento ou cancelar a subscrição a qualquer momento.
    Formulário de candidatura